Confucius did not start a religious system of that concerned itself with origins of the universe, God/gods, or the afterlife, but rather he taught an ethical philosophical system that dealt with the proper relationships between individuals in families, businesses, government, and society.

Why did Confucius believe that China needed to return to ethics?

Confucius believed that China needed to return to ethics because he saw that society was in a state of moral decline and chaos. He believed that a focus on ethical principles, such as filial piety, respect for elders, and honesty, would lead to personal and societal harmony. By cultivating virtue and moral behavior, Confucius believed that individuals and society as a whole could achieve peace, stability, and prosperity.


What kind of students did Confucius like to teach?

Confucius liked to teach students who were eager to learn, respectful, and open-minded. He valued qualities such as humility, diligence, and a strong sense of moral character in his students. Confucius believed in the transformative power of education and believed that students who possessed these qualities would be most receptive to his teachings.


Confucius believed that society would do well if every one did his or here?

Confucius believed that society would thrive if everyone fulfilled their social roles and responsibilities. He emphasized the importance of moral character, integrity, and filial piety. He believed that if individuals acted virtuously and fulfilled their obligations to family and society, harmony and order would prevail in the community.
